About Northwestern Polytechnical University
Academics
NPU offers a wide array of degree programs across fundamental science, engineering, humanities, management, and social sciences. The university is particularly renowned for its strengths in Aerospace Science and Technology, Material Science and Engineering, and Mechanics, which consistently rank among the top in Chinese universities. NPU emphasizes a hands-on, research-oriented approach to learning, providing platforms and facilities to attract scholars and support overseas exchange programs. The material science discipline at NPU ranks among the top 0.1% globally, with chemistry, engineering, and computer science also in the top 1%.
International Students
NPU actively recruits international students, with a diverse community representing over 107 nationalities. The university offers numerous English-taught programs at the bachelor's, master's, and doctoral levels, including Aeronautical Engineering, Mechanical Engineering, Electronics & Information Engineering, and Business Administration. Support services for international students include accommodation information, airport pick-up, guidance on Chinese visas, and assistance with opening bank accounts. NPU also hosts cultural events like the "Cultural Bridge" New Year's Gala to promote cultural integration and celebrate diversity.
Campus & Location
NPU boasts two campuses in Xi'an: the Youyi Campus and the Chang'an Campus. The Youyi Campus is situated opposite the historic West Market, while the Chang'an Campus is nestled at the foot of the Qinling Mountains. Xi'an, as an ancient capital and a growing technological hub, offers a rich cultural experience with historical sites like the Terracotta Army. The city provides a balance of cultural richness and modern development, with convenient transportation including six subway lines.
